EdmFunctions.Substring(DbExpression, DbExpression, DbExpression) Yöntem

Tanım

DbFunctionExpression Bir dize ve tamsayı sayısal sonuç türlerine sahip olması gereken belirtilen bağımsız değişkenlerle kurallı 'Alt Dize' işlevini çağıran bir oluşturur. İfadenin sonuç türü dizedir.

public:
[System::Runtime::CompilerServices::Extension]
 static System::Data::Common::CommandTrees::DbFunctionExpression ^ Substring(System::Data::Common::CommandTrees::DbExpression ^ stringArgument, System::Data::Common::CommandTrees::DbExpression ^ start, System::Data::Common::CommandTrees::DbExpression ^ length);
public static System.Data.Common.CommandTrees.DbFunctionExpression Substring (this System.Data.Common.CommandTrees.DbExpression stringArgument, System.Data.Common.CommandTrees.DbExpression start, System.Data.Common.CommandTrees.DbExpression length);
static member Substring : System.Data.Common.CommandTrees.DbExpression * System.Data.Common.CommandTrees.DbExpression * System.Data.Common.CommandTrees.DbExpression -> System.Data.Common.CommandTrees.DbFunctionExpression
<Extension()>
Public Function Substring (stringArgument As DbExpression, start As DbExpression, length As DbExpression) As DbFunctionExpression

Parametreler

stringArgument
DbExpression

Alt dizenin ayıklandığı dizeyi belirten ifade.

start
DbExpression

Alt dizenin alınması gereken başlangıç dizinini belirten ifade.

length
DbExpression

Alt dizenin uzunluğunu belirten bir ifade.

Döndürülenler

konumundan startbaşlayarak uzunluğun lengthstringArgument alt dizesini döndüren yeni bir DbFunctionExpression.

Özel durumlar

stringArgument, startveya length şeklindedir null.

stringArgument, startveya length geçersiz.

Açıklamalar

Alt dize, başlangıç tarafından belirtilen dizinin b 1 tabanlı</b>> olmasını <gerektirir.

Şunlara uygulanır